Scouting Report & Player Insights
Tim Skarke is a German attacking midfielder/forward known for his tireless work rate and directness, traits well suited to 1. FC Union Berlin's combative, high-pressing identity. He offers energy off the ball, timely runs into the box, and occasional goal contributions rather than being a primary creative outlet. Having risen through lower German leagues before establishing himself in the Bundesliga, he remains a solid squad option rather than a headline name.
